Q: Why do exported reports show different times than the Larkbend dashboard?

A: Exports are always rendered in UTC; the dashboard uses the viewer's profile timezone. This is intentional. Do not "fix" it by shifting export timestamps — downstream ingest at Quillport expects UTC. If a client insists on local time, use the timezone override flag in the export job config. The flag reference is on the internal page below.

dashboard of tahop-fahof = https://harbor.tolvaqnet.example/secrets/merge_requests/board/issue/merge_requests/pipeline/secrets/ecb30ed86a55c001a77f6cb9

**Q: Why does the Vellumo PDF invoice renderer sometimes drop line-item footnotes?**

A: Footnotes longer than the reserved footer region are truncated silently in the legacy layout engine. The new engine wraps them onto a continuation page, but it's only enabled for tenants on the Birchline plan. The rollout schedule and per-tenant flags are tracked on the internal page below.

operations page: https://confluence.tolvaqlabs.internal/pages/pages/browse/display/894b

### Step 2: Point the audit-log viewer at the new store

Ledgerlens 4.x reads from the consolidated event store. Stop the old indexer first, then update the viewer's connection settings. Don't migrate retention policies yet — that's step 3. Verify search works against last week's events before proceeding. Apply the following configuration values.

settings of kawig-kahip:
ULAETH_PIN=4988
ULAETH_TENANT=briath
ULAETH_METRICS_HOST=metrics.ulaeth.xolmarworks.test
ULAETH_SEAL=seal_e1a2fe42
ULAETH_STANDBY_TEAM=pelix